And we know that in all things God works for the good of those who love Him, who have been called according to His purpose (Romans 8:28, NIV).

God has a plan to take every adversity and every hardship you go through and use it. He takes that difficulty and supernaturally turns it around and uses it to bring you good. How do we live more victorious?

Last night in our Bible study group, we talked about what happens if we have weak muscles. If we have muscles that we have not used correctly, we might begin a weight training program to grow in strength and skill. When we apply this same principle to our faith, we build our faith by reading God’s word, retraining our thought process to line up with Biblical truth. Just like weight lifters need a spotter at times, we need a spotter to encourage, challenge and support us in this faith building process. Godly friends are so important.

One of the most important faith building steps is to  KNOW what the word of God says about our lives. Often our world view and past experiences shapes OUR VERSION of truth. We need to remember that the past is a place of reference NOT a place of residence.  To become more victorious, we have to align our beliefs with the truth of the Bible.  Another way to say this is, we  don’t just read the Bible, we need to let it read us.

2 Corth. 10:5 says that every thought should be examined for Godly accuracy. IF is does not line up with what the Bible says, we must take it captive and make it obedient to the word of God.

Today, may we stand on the unmoving word of God. May we be doers of the word and not just hearers only. Let’s TRUST the one that loves the process ~ It is in the process that we learn to trust the Lord without borders. To cross to the other side of the mountain with only a leap of faith.

Philippians 4:8  tells us, Finally, brothers and sisters, whatever is true, whatever is noble, whatever is right, whatever is pure, whatever is lovely, whatever is admirable—if anything is excellent or praiseworthy—think about such things

If we want to live more victorious, if we want to  make the world a better place,  take a look at yourself in the mirror with Biblical truths, then make that…Change.
